Re: any word on 780 ti classified bios fix 2014/04/26 17:25:51 (permalink)
What is this new bios for? Better voltage controll only?

Re: any word on 780 ti classified bios fix 2014/04/26 17:36:37 (permalink)
Unlocking the voltage and providing better overclocking as well as voltage control through the classified voltage tool (found on OVERCLOCK.NET in the classified owners thread, page 1 post 1 at the bottom)
